Java used memory size
Ajust the memory usage by Java according to your needs. When using memory intensive tasks as mzIdentML conversion of large files, an adjustement of the Java Xmx values may be required. The default is the usage of 13 GB of your RAM. Please refer to the Java documentation for further information. http://docs.oracle.com/javase/7/docs/technotes/tools/solaris/java.html In Ursgal the parameter java_-Xmx can be used to adjust the Java memory usage.

Windows general¶
Some modules can not be compiled/installed with python3.4+ using pip.
E.g. pyahocorasick can not be installed. This has the consequence, that on Windows the old peptide mapper version is used. There are several workarounds to compile and install the modules manually, e.g.:
